What is a Single Integrated Oven?
A single integrated oven is a built-in cooking home appliance developed to be seamlessly integrated into kitchen cabinets. Unlike standard freestanding ovens, single integrated ovens are particularly crafted for a smooth, space-saving effect without protruding into the kitchen layout. This makes them an appealing alternative for modern cooking areas where aesthetic appeals and company are crucial.

Frequently Asked Questions About Single Integrated Ovens1. How do I clean up a single integrated oven?
Most single integrated ovens include self-cleaning options. However, for manual cleaning, it is advisable to use a non-abrasive cleaner and prevent severe chemicals that can harm the device's finish.
2. Can you cook multiple meals simultaneously?
Yes, lots of single integrated ovens, particularly convection models, enable for multi-level cooking. Nevertheless, make sure that the meals do not have conflicting cooking times or temperatures for optimum results.
3. What's the typical expense of a single integrated oven?
The price of single integrated High Quality Ovens differs widely based on functions and brand, ranging from ₤ 800 to over ₤ 3,000. It is important to compare designs and ensure they fulfill cooking requirements within spending plan limits.
4. Are single integrated ovens energy effective?
Normally, single integrated ovens are developed to be more energy-efficient than conventional ovens, frequently featuring energy-saving modes and insulation to preserve temperature.
5. Can I install a single integrated oven myself?
While setup might seem simple, it is suggested to hire a professional for electrical and pipes connections to make sure safety and compliance with regional policies.
